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
98 6829583974 39270926
9038359 1493172
9038359 1493172
659409308 59 3895615331
All about undefined
Interested in learning more?
9038359 1493172
659409308 59 3895615331
See more
481 609
3616335628 54632950341 52636169 309795418 90
See more
777 31033451931
2012 912116 04
See more